I bought some "State" half-runner beans to grow in the 3 Sisters garden since I found out too late that sweet corn will not support the vigorous vines of the pole beans (I'm already eye-to-eye with the top of my Trionfo Violettas).

I can't find much in the way of description for this variety. It seems to be very popular around here but its sold from the loose bins in the small feed and farm supply stores with nothing much on it but its name. What can you tell me about it? Especially, do they freeze well?

Also, if using half-runner beans works well in the 3 Sisters garden, does anyone know of any purple or yellow varieties? I prefer purple and yellow beans because I lose green ones among the leaves (I expect this to be worse with squash leaves to deal with too), and then the plants stop producing.
